Small Size High-precision TDL45IMU Laser Inertial Unit Large Impact Large Vibration
This type of laser inertial unit has the advantages of small size, light weight, low power consumption, and high accuracy. It contains eight points of vibration reduction and can meet the application scenarios of large impact and large vibration. It can be used to design pure strap down and meet the needs of new unmanned platforms, water/torpedo weapons, as well as land, airborne, and missile weapon platforms for small size and high-precision inertial unit equipment. It has the dynamic measurement function of carrier angular motion and linear motion information.
